Allows you to create a new config context where you can define new options with default values.
This method allows you to open up the configurable more than once.
For example:
config_context
:server_info do
configurable(:url).defaults_to("http://localhost")
end
Parameters¶ ↑
symbol<Symbol>: the name of the context block<Block>: a block that will be run in the context of this new config class.
# File lib/mixlib/config.rb, line 313 def config_context(symbol, &block) if configurables.has_key?(symbol) raise ReopenedConfigurableWithConfigContextError, "Cannot redefine config value #{symbol} with a config context" end if config_contexts.has_key?(symbol) context = config_contexts[symbol] else context = Class.new context.extend(::Mixlib::Config) context.config_parent = self config_contexts[symbol] = context define_attr_accessor_methods(symbol) end if block context.instance_eval(&block) end context end
Gets or sets strict mode. When strict mode is on, only values which were specified with configurable(), default() or writes_with() may be retrieved or set. Getting or setting anything else will cause Mixlib::Config::UnknownConfigOptionError
to be thrown.
If this is set to :warn, unknown values may be get or set, but a warning will be printed with Chef::Log.warn if this occurs.
Parameters¶ ↑
- value<String>
-
pass this value to set strict mode [optional]
Returns¶ ↑
Current value of config_strict_mode
Raises¶ ↑
- <ArgumentError>
-
if value is set to something other than true, false, or :warn
# File lib/mixlib/config.rb, line 354 def config_strict_mode(value = NOT_PASSED) if value == NOT_PASSED if @config_strict_mode.nil? if config_parent config_parent.config_strict_mode else false end else @config_strict_mode end else self.config_strict_mode = value end end

metaprogramming to set information about a config option. This may be used in one of two ways:
-
Block-based:
configurable(:attr) do
defaults_to 4 writes_value { |value| 10 }
end
-
Chain-based:
configurable(:attr).defaults_to(4).writes_value { |value| 10 }
Currently supported configuration:
defaults_to(value): value returned when configurable has no explicit value defaults_to BLOCK: block is run when the configurable has no explicit value writes_value BLOCK: block that is run to filter a value when it is being set
Parameters¶ ↑
- symbol<Symbol>
-
Name of the config option
- default_value<Object>
-
Default value [optional]
- block<Block>
-
Logic block that calculates default value [optional]
Returns¶ ↑
The value of the config option.
# File lib/mixlib/config.rb, line 284 def configurable(symbol, &block) unless configurables[symbol] if config_contexts.has_key?(symbol) raise ReopenedConfigContextWithConfigurableError, "Cannot redefine config_context #{symbol} as a configurable value" end configurables[symbol] = Configurable.new(symbol) define_attr_accessor_methods(symbol) end if block yield(configurables[symbol]) end configurables[symbol] end

Loads a given ruby file, and runs instance_eval against it in the context of the current object.
Raises an IOError if the file cannot be found, or is not readable.
Parameters¶ ↑
- filename<String>
-
A filename to read from
# File lib/mixlib/config.rb, line 51 def from_file(filename) self.instance_eval(IO.read(filename), filename, 1) end

Makes a copy of any non-default values.
This returns a shallow copy of the hash; while the hash itself is duplicated a la dup, modifying data inside arrays and hashes may modify the original Config
object.
Returns¶ ↑
Hash of values the user has set.
Examples¶ ↑
For example, this config class:
class MyConfig < Mixlib::Config default :will_be_set, 1 default :will_be_set_to_default, 1 default :will_not_be_set, 1 configurable(:computed_value) { |x| x*2 } config_context :group do default :will_not_be_set, 1 end config_context :group_never_set end MyConfig.x = 2 MyConfig.will_be_set = 2 MyConfig.will_be_set_to_default = 1 MyConfig.computed_value = 2 MyConfig.group.x = 3
produces this:
MyConfig.save == { :x => 2, :will_be_set => 2, :will_be_set_to_default => 1, :computed_value => 4, :group => { :x => 3 } }
# File lib/mixlib/config.rb, line 161 def save(include_defaults = false) result = self.configuration.dup if include_defaults (self.configurables.keys - result.keys).each do |missing_default| # Ask any configurables to save themselves into the result array if self.configurables[missing_default].has_default result[missing_default] = self.configurables[missing_default].default end end end self.config_contexts.each_pair do |key, context| context_result = context.save(include_defaults) result[key] = context_result if context_result.size != 0 || include_defaults end result end
